II.1.4) Short description

Betsi Cadwaladr University Health Board requires a contractor for the provisions for an automatic door maintenance contract. The contract will be let for three years with the option to extend for two further 12-month periods (3 +1 +1)

Due to the large geographical area of the Health Board, the requirement is being split into three (3) lots as below:

Lot 1: Central Region

Lot 2: West Region

Lot 3: East region
